Follow-up letter regarding customer feedback on a new type of radiator for chassis II6.GN.

Lidsey}3/MA.30.12.32, this owner called upon us a few days ago and we asked him if he was satisfied with the new type radiator. He replied that up to the present, no overheating had occurred; however, he intends making a long tour in the summer and he will then let us have his opinion as to the cooling qualities of the radiator.
